After the new Panchayat Gram building and the chairman’s meeting in Janaspandan in Melkunda (B) in the Kalaburagi district, these field programs have shown a government commitment to civil proceedings.
“This is the sixth Janaspandana program in the election district. People no longer have to chase officials in government offices, we bring a government to them. During the session, a total of 112 petitions were adopted, from which 11 complaints were resolved.”
He responded to public feedback and stated that questions about development should be aware of the ongoing effort. “We are implementing several developing projects with multiple CRORY. Our warranty schemes reflect the government’s commitment to progress,” he added.
The MLA has distributed the benefits of social security, such as the widow and old -fashioned pensions during the meeting, and promised that in the coming days the provision of these services will be ensured for eligible recipients.
Several citizens have made complaints, including lack of proper bus facilities and inconsistencies of employment within government programs. Some residents also pointed to the delay in the missionary work of Jal Jeevan. Farmers demanded the new Raith Sampark Kendra (RSK) and thanked the government for paying the requirements for crop insurance.
“The amount of 15.13 GBP Crore was paid to 735 Melkunda farmers to compensate for crop loss, which is part of the Crore 635 GBP paid across the Kalaburagagi,” Patil said to be more actively used. He ordered the officials of the Agriculture Department to start the campaign to actively raise awareness and actively collect premium payments.

Petitions have been solved
Of the 112 applications received at the Janaspandan meeting, 11 were immediately resolved. Petitions related to the Jal Jeevan mission, water and water problems, bus services, schemes, widow’s pension and Sandhya Surraksha and are reviewed. Mr. Patil assured that measures would be taken within one week and in cases where compensation was not possible, the petitioners would receive a clear explanation.
